I think it would be easier to find my favorite moment(s) about each episode rather than pick a single episode as a favorite. I’ll try to do both. Hope you don’t mind that I need to gush a bit about the show. For me, it is often the small things that I tend to watch over and over again. 2.01 – Sam checking Andy out to make sure she was okay, the face touch, the way he was unable to stop himself from leaning in to kiss her and the fact that honestly, she wasn’t trying to stop him until she saw the guy with the gun behind him. But I also loved how he kept watch over her at the station, the way he checked on her when she was talking to the roommate and the way he let her do what she needed to do to make sense of it all. And of course, I totally loved Andy catching the bad guy.2.02 – “We make a good team, you and I.” 2.03 – “Okay, but if you start to transform…” pats his gun, “I’m not going to think twice.” Love how he makes her laugh and how much he loves to make her laugh.2.04 – The Ollie/Sam conversation, both when Sam first arrives on the scene and when he tries to tell Sam to talk to Andy. Actually I just loved Oliver this whole episode, from his hate of the hose monkeys to punishing Andy for her cheesy comforting comment…:haha: …to his Sammy talks. Great stuff! Worst scene: Jo the Ho goes to the fire department and says “over there” to them like they can’t see the burnt out building and she is the be all know all person in charge. GAG! Actually I hated her through the entire episode. I really wanted Andy to say to her (in her office after her vice grip on someone she loves comment and crazy eyes) “You should be careful with that Jo…before you know it you will be boiling bunnies and getting shot in a bathtub in a really ugly white dress.” 2.05 – Sammy as a car salesman. I totally bought it. LOL He’s just so good at that sort of thing. 2.06 – Andy putting Jo the Ho in her place when Jo the Ho was acting like she was doing her a favor by taking the blame for the girl getting away. “That’s not a story, that’s what happened.” Yay for Andy for not putting up with her BS. 2.07 – Sam’s stare/glare of hate to Jo when he figures out what happened. But I also loved the way that Ben Bass delivered his line “…for what? A guy who put a ring on your finger and then cheated on you?” The way his voice broke when he said “cheated” broke my heart for him and how broken and pissed he was for her and at her. But I have to say that I never thought she was doing it for Luke so much as she went with a gut feeling about this guy. I don’t think she did it for Luke, I think she was trying to be a good cop, even if it meant listening to something her ex said. So I really liked that even after Sam left her, she continued on with her gut feeling. I loved that she was the one that found the proof to nail the sicko. 2.08 – Everything about this episode I loved. I can’t say one bad thing about it. Not one. I really think it is probably my overall favorite episode S1 & S2. So much goodness with all the characters, but especially with Sam and Andy. I especially loved the looks of respect that both Ollie & Sam had for her over the correct way to have played that hand of poker. Ollie’s smile at Sam was like “and just another reason to love her, Brother”. Loved all of Ollie’s one-liners. I loved Andy bringing Chris into the case, Sam listening to both of them. Loved his smile at her when she made him hang up the phone and not give the case over to the 27th. Loved the smiles, the looks, the working together, and finally the boxing. I’ve watched this episode about 25 times. Love it! 2.09 – Loved the way Sam stared at Andy when Frank said to look at the person next to you and then continued to stare at her after Frank said “moving on”. Andy was so uncomfortable. 2.10 – Another great episode, but again it is the little things that I love the most and in this episode it was when Sam and Andy are interviewing the chicken and Sam says “I’d be surprised, big chicken coming at me.” And he looks at Andy trying not to smirk and she’s trying not to laugh and gives him a “behave!” look and he clenches his mouth as he tries to not smile as he turns back to questioning the chicken. I just love that moment. It was so….telling...for lack of a better word that he says these things to entertain her and at the same time it was almost…couplely (is that even a word?) that she silently reprimanded him and he tried to behave himself. I also loved that huge smile on his face when she was grinning at him when she found out the boy was found. He does so love her smile. Let’s not forget the expression “don’t shoot where you eat”. 2.11 – While I loved loved loved all the Sam & Andy moments and love-making, I really go back to that table in the bar scene when he tells her that he’s been wondering why he got into the business to begin with. I love that he’s been thinking about that. I also love how he loves to see her smile, once again. 2.12 – Another outstanding episode with lots of Sam & Andy goodness, both together and separately. But it was the little things that made my favorite things list: his little laugh as he says “maybe 20” and pulls her back to bed…so sexy! Love the way he is looking at her and leaning in when she’s talking about unlike Sam, JD is a perfect gentleman. His little “ahmmm” as she describes the goodness of JD was so sexy to me for some reason. And then the way he touched her hair and sort of pulled her to him for a kiss. Loved how comfortable, flirty, sexy and happy Andy was with him. I wasn’t sure what we would get from her on a morning after…but LOVED IT! 2.13 – Wow! So many great things, from story to acting to directing to emotions. Loved seeing the Rooks work together to get Sam back. Loved Gail in this episode. Not a great fan of hers normally but really liked her here. She didn’t hesitate, she just jumped in. I sort of hope we get some more scenes between Andy and Gail in S3 (that have nothing to do with Luke) because we really haven’t gotten that many up to this point and I liked them riding together and figuring out what was going on. Loved Sam telling Boyd that Andy was 10 times the cop he would ever be and then walking away from him. Loved that Sam sought Andy out and asked her to try normal with him. I think their normal isn’t what most people consider normal, but that’s the thing, normal isn’t the same for everyone. My normal isn’t the same normal as the majority of people…but it’s normal for me. I think the same is being told by Andy & Sam, it’s defining what their normal is and I think that is what Sam wants Andy to understand. If that makes sense. But my overall favorite scene of the show was the “Ask me to stay. Stay.” Kiss. It felt so intimate that I almost had to look away as I felt I was invading their privacy. Perfect tone, perfect delivery, perfect kiss. Sorry this is so long. I hope it's okay. |
